    Honours Thesis: Piezoelectric for Generating Electricity Designed and developed a modular piezoelectric tile system that generates power from footsteps. The system uses an array of piezoelectric sensors arranged in a scalable tile architecture.

    How does it work? In Layman's terms, when mechanical stress is applied to piezoelectric materials, kinetic energy is converted into electrical energy. The generated output is then normalized (rectified and regulated) through power electronics, enabling the harvested energy to power low-power devices. This thesis explores the potential of piezoelectric harvesting systems as a sustainable solution for capturing wasted energy in high footfall environments.
